My Protector Is Allah Who Sent Down the Book — He Befriends the Righteous

إِنَّ وَلِيِّۦَ ٱللَّهُ ٱلَّذِي نَزَّلَ ٱلۡكِتَٰبَ
— الأعراف الآية 196
Verse: "My protector is Allah who sent down the Book and He befriends the righteous." (7:196) — The Prophet ﷺ declares in the face of threats: my protector is Allah — I need no human protector. "He befriends the righteous" — righteousness is the condition for divine friendship, not lineage or wealth. Lesson: the person who possesses this trust in Allah cannot be intimidated or crushed — the strength of the protected is from the strength of the Protector.
Source: Ibn Kathir (3/519); Al-Sadi
